ResQ133A-NMIBC: Intravesical Recombinant Mycobacterium (rMBCG) in Participants With NMIBC Eligible to Receive Intravesical Tice BCG

NCT06800963 · Status: RECRUITING · Phase: PHASE1/PHASE2 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 40

Summary

This is a phase 1/2, open-label, multicenter study of intravesical Recombinant Mycobacterium Bacillus Calmette-Guérin (BCG) in participants with Non-muscle invasive bladder cancer (NMIBC) who have not received Bacillus Calmette-Guérin and have histologically confirmed presence of Carcinoma in situ (CIS) or have primary or recurrent stage Ta and/or T1 papillary tumors following Transurethral resection.
